RE: Moen vs Price Fister fixtures

Price Pfister is a Black & Decker company. I have sold thousands of faucets and would never buy or sell Price Pfister. It's a low quality faucet and they have poor customer service.

Moen is a good midle of the road faucet, I had one for 20 years with 0 problems. I would recommend Moen.

Kohler is a better product with excellent customer service and they give a lifetime warrenty on every faucet they sell! Yes, lifetime since 1997!
